当前位置:首页 / EXCEL

Excel date函数怎么用?如何快速获取日期?

作者:佚名|分类:EXCEL|浏览:193|发布时间:2025-04-14 02:37:14

Excel Date Function: 如何快速获取日期

在Excel中,日期函数是处理日期和时间数据的重要工具。通过使用这些函数,用户可以轻松地计算日期、提取日期的特定部分、格式化日期以及执行各种日期相关的操作。本文将详细介绍Excel中的Date函数及其使用方法,并探讨如何快速获取日期。

一、Excel Date函数概述

Excel的Date函数用于返回特定日期的序列号。序列号是一个连续的数字,代表从1900年1月1日到指定日期的天数。这个函数对于日期的计算和比较非常有用。

二、Date函数的基本语法

Date函数的基本语法如下:

```

DATE(year, month, day)

```

year:表示年份的整数。

month:表示月份的整数(1-12)。

day:表示日期的整数(1-31)。

三、Date函数的使用示例

1. 获取当前日期

要获取当前日期,可以直接使用Date函数:

```

=DATE(TODAY())

```

2. 计算两个日期之间的天数

要计算两个日期之间的天数,可以使用Date函数减去另一个日期:

```

=DATE(2022, 1, 1) DATE(2021, 1, 1)

```

3. 提取日期的特定部分

提取年份:

```

=YEAR(DATE(2022, 1, 1))

```

提取月份:

```

=MONTH(DATE(2022, 1, 1))

```

提取日期:

```

=DAY(DATE(2022, 1, 1))

```

4. 格式化日期

要格式化日期,可以使用Text函数:

```

=TEXT(DATE(2022, 1, 1), "yyyy-mm-dd")

```

四、如何快速获取日期

1. 使用Today函数

Today函数可以直接返回当前日期:

```

=Today()

```

2. 使用Now函数

Now函数可以返回当前日期和时间:

```

=Now()

```

3. 使用Date函数结合其他函数

例如,要获取下个月的日期,可以使用以下公式:

```

=DATE(YEAR(TODAY()), MONTH(TODAY()) + 1, 1)

```

五、相关问答

1. 问:Date函数是否支持负数年份?

答:是的,Date函数支持负数年份。在Excel中,1900年1月1日是序列号的起始点,因此可以使用负数年份来表示1900年之前的日期。

2. 问:如何将日期转换为文本格式?

答:可以使用Text函数将日期转换为文本格式。例如,要将日期转换为“2022-01-01”的格式,可以使用以下公式:

```

=TEXT(DATE(2022, 1, 1), "yyyy-mm-dd")

```

3. 问:如何获取当前月份的第一天?

答:可以使用以下公式获取当前月份的第一天:

```

=DATE(YEAR(TODAY()), MONTH(TODAY()), 1)

```

4. 问:如何获取当前年份的最后一天?

答:可以使用以下公式获取当前年份的最后一天:

```

=DATE(YEAR(TODAY()) + 1, 1, 0) 1

```

总结

Excel的Date函数是处理日期和时间数据的重要工具。通过掌握Date函数的使用方法,用户可以轻松地完成各种日期相关的操作。本文详细介绍了Date函数的基本语法、使用示例以及如何快速获取日期。希望对您有所帮助。